Pros

You get a fair bit of freedom, the campus is pretty, access to seminars and smart people

Cons

living on soft money is painful. In my field (applied energy sciences), the funders fund uninspiring work and micromanage projects. It's not LBNL's fault, but the whole environment stifles creativity.

Pros

work life balance; World-Class User Facilities and Instruments, Top-Tier Scientific Collaboration

Cons

Temporary Nature of Early-Career Roles: For postdoctoral researchers, positions are inherently temporary. Securing a permanent Staff Scientist role at a national lab is notoriously difficult due to limited openings and highly competitive, lifelong tenures, which often forces researchers to look externally for long-term career growth.
